Safety First: Ensuring a Protective Interior

1. Airbags:

  • Airbags are vital safety features that protect occupants in the event of a crash. Ensure all airbags are properly inflated and maintained.
  • The NHTSA estimates that airbags have saved over 50,000 lives since 1987.

2. Seatbelts:

  • Seatbelts are your most important safety device. Always wear them properly, even for short trips.
  • According to The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), seatbelts reduce the risk of fatal injuries by 45%.

3. Emergency Equipment:

  • Keep essential emergency equipment in your car, such as a first-aid kit, flashlight, and emergency flares.
  • The American Red Cross recommends preparing a comprehensive emergency kit for your vehicle.

Tips and Tricks for a Pleasant Interior

  • Use scented candles or air fresheners to create a refreshing atmosphere.
  • Keep a portable charger in your car to avoid battery dead zones.
  • Tinted windows can provide privacy and reduce sun glare.
  • Regularly clean and vacuum your car's interior to maintain hygiene and freshness.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Avoid eating or drinking in your car to prevent spills and stains.
  • Don't smoke in your car as it damages the interior and poses health risks.
  • Don't overload your car with unnecessary items that can obstruct your view or cause distractions.
  • Neglecting regular maintenance can lead to mechanical issues and safety hazards.

FAQs on Car Interiors

  1. How often should I clean my car's interior?
    - Answer: At least once a month or more frequently if needed.

  2. How can I reduce noise levels in my car?
    - Answer: Install sound-absorbing materials, upgrade to quieter tires, or consider a noise-canceling sound system.

  3. Is it safe to use electronic devices while driving?
    - Answer: While some hands-free devices are legal, using electronic devices while driving can be distracting and increase the risk of accidents.

  4. What are some ways to customize my car's interior?
    - Answer: Choose seat covers, floor mats, steering wheel covers, and other accessories that reflect your style.

  5. How do I ensure my car's interior is safe for my family?
    - Answer: Keep airbags and seatbelts in good condition, install child safety seats properly, and remove any potential hazards.

  6. What are some essential emergency items to keep in my car?
    - Answer: First-aid kit, flashlight, emergency flares, jumper cables, and a spare tire.
